One has to wonder what is it about the marriage of Aphrodite and Hephaistos that lends itself so easily to sanitisation and romanticisation. Sure, it is not even comparable to the romanticisation and sanitisation of Hades and Persephone, but at least this second one has in its favour the fact that the relationship seems harmonious enough after its violent beginning, and that Persephone becomes her husband's equal with unparalleled authority over the Underworld. But Hephaistos and Aphrodite… What do we have there? An arranged marriage, a public infidelity scandal, a public humiliation, a separation (in the Odyssey Hephaistos demands that the gifts he gave to Zeus in exchange for Aphrodite's hand be returned to him,, in the Library of Apollodoros it is claimed that Hephaistos tried to rape Athena after he was deserted by Aphrodite, and Nonnos mentions their divorce as well), even an instance of the betrayed spouse taking revenge on their partner's affair child. If anything, it could be argued that these two have far more in common with Zeus and Hera than with Hades and Persephone. And yet…
In one of the retellings I've read recently, Aphrodite is portrayed as an entirely devoted and loving wife to Hephaistos; incidentally, Zeus and Hera are the only unhappily married couple in the pantheon. In another, Aphrodite and Hephaistos have a complicated but ultimately mutually loving marriage; she was married off to him without being asked, but she wanted it actually and even if she cheats on him, she loves him and wants him to pay attention to her. By contrast, Zeus and Hera's relationship is completely terrible; she only married him because he raped her, she hates him, and it very much looks like they are the only example of a loveless marriage among the gods. In another one, while Zeus and Hera are portrayed in a pretty mythologically accurate way with everything that entails, Aphrodite is once again the incredibly loving and devoted wife of Hephaistos and she even turns against all the other gods for his sake. And in yet another, Aphrodite does sleep around, but she is supportive and kind and loving to Hephaistos, whereas Zeus is an one-dimensional, evil bastard who is incredibly abusive towards Hera and nothing beyond that. And these are just a few examples, all from books I've read these few past weeks, but these kinds of interpretations are quite popular and commonly encountered in Greek myth-based stories. I could list so many titles, of both published books and retellings on the internet, where this spin on the myths is used, where some "problematic" relationships are made pretty and sweet and loving, while others are allowed to stay problematic or are deliberately made even worse.
But why are these interpretations so common? What is this all about? Is it the fact that Aphrodite is a woman, so it is easier to disregard her infidelity? Or that people find it very easy to sympathise with Hephaistos, so they like to imagine that his wife does actually desire and love him whereas Hera is a far less sympathetic character and people enjoy to portray Zeus in the most negative manner possible? Or is it the appeal of an unattractive man (obligatory note that Hephaistos is never called ugly in ancient Greek sources) being loved by the most beautiful woman? Is it a way to "redeem" Aphrodite, as if she needs such a thing and as if that's the way to do it? Is it all of that? Something else? I wish I knew. I wish I understood on what basis people decide which mythological relationships deserve to be whitewashed.
Currently, my theory is that generally it is all about the male characters involved; not really about the women or about the myths. That is to say, it is about whether or not people love the male characters. People generally love Hades, so they like to imagine that Persephone loves him too, that she went with him of her own accord, that she wanted him from the beginning. If it was about her rather than him, retellings wouldn't so frequently have her be sexually assaulted by other gods or men, wouldn't so frequently make her a nobody when she is at Demeter's side and entirely dependent on her husband for power and respect, wouldn't so frequently disrespect her relationship with her mother. If it was about the myth, they wouldn't so frequently remove the kidnapping. People generally dislike/hate Zeus, so of course he must be the worst™ and whatever. The idea that he raped Hera and she had no choice but to marry him (source?) is not as popular and frequently used in retellings as it is because it is just so well attested in the myths (it is really not), or because people care oh so much about Hera (she is among the most hated mythological figures), but because it reinforces the image of Zeus as the worst™. And since he is the worst™, of course he doesn't care for the one goddess whom he has chosen to stay married to forever regardless of all conflicts and betrayals. People generally love Hephaistos, so Aphrodite has to love him too, or she must be a villain if she does not. If it was about Aphrodite, not being faithful to her husband wouldn't be considered something that needs to be fixed. To be fair, maybe it is not so much about Hephaistos either, since he has other wives and this marriage is not an essential or central aspect of his mythology any more than it is for Aphrodite, yet all too often it is treated like it is.
